Abstract
Methods, systems, and apparatus, including computer programs encoded on a computer storage medium, for performing an A/B test on a target element of an online platform. In one aspect, a method comprises: conducting an A/B test on a target element of an online platform, comprising: for each user in a population of users, measuring: (i) an outcome of the user interacting with the online platform, and (ii) an interaction of the user with a mediator element of the online platform; and determining, based on the A/B test, a direct effect value that estimates an expected change in user outcomes when the test version of the target element is presented instead of the control version of the target element that is caused independently of induced changes in user interaction with the mediator element.
